2017-2022年南京市水痘突发公共卫生事件的空间聚集特征分析  

Spatial clustering analysis of varicella public health emergency events in Nanjing City from 2017 to 2022

摘  要:目的了解2017—2022年南京市水痘突发公共卫生事件的空间聚集特征,为制定水痘疫情防控策略提供依据。方法通过中国疾病预防控制信息系统突发公共卫生事件管理信息系统,收集2017—2022年南京市水痘突发公共卫生事件资料,采用ArcGIS 10.2软件进行趋势面分析、空间自相关分析和热点分析,了解南京市水痘突发公共卫生事件的空间聚集特征。结果2017—2022年南京市累计报告水痘突发公共卫生事件84起,病例2558例,平均水痘罹患率为2.53%。事件级别以一般事件为主,76起占90.48%。趋势面分析结果显示,2017—2022年南京市水痘突发公共卫生事件呈现西低东高、北低南高的特征;全局空间自相关分析结果显示,2017年和2019年水痘突发公共卫生事件在乡镇尺度上呈空间正相关,存在空间聚集性(P<0.05);热点分析提示高发区域为江宁区、高淳区、雨花台区和建邺区。结论2017—2022年南京市水痘突发公共卫生事件存在空间聚集性,主要集中在江宁区、高淳区等郊区。Objective To investigate the spatial clustering characteristics of varicella public health emergency events in Nanjing City from 2017 to 2022,so as to provide the evidence for the development of varicella prevention and control strategies.Methods Data of varicella public health emergency events in Nanjing City from 2017 to 2022 were collect⁃ed through Emergency Public Health Management Information System of Chinese Disease Prevention and Control Informa⁃tion System.The software ArcGIS 10.2 was employed for trend-surface analysis,spatial autocorrelation analysis and hot⁃spot analysis to understand the spatial clustering characteristics of varicella public health emergency events.Results A total of 84 varicella public health emergency events were reported in Nanjing City from 2017 to 2022,with an average attack rate of 2.53%(2558 cases).Ⅳ-level events were predominant,accounting for 90.48%(76 events).The trend surface analysis showed lower incidence of varicella public health emergency events in the west of Nanjing City and higher in the east,and lower in the north and higher in the south.The global spatial autocorrelation analysis showed that there was a positive spatial correlation in varicella public health emergency events in 2017 and 2019,indicating spatial clustering(P<0.05).The hot spots were Jiangning District,Gaochun District,Yuhuatai District and Jianye Dis⁃trict.Conclusion The incidence of varicella public health emergency events in Nanjing City from 2017 to 2022 has spatial aggregation,with a concentration in suburban areas such as Jiangning District and Gaochun District.
